How they compare
Germany currently reports 80,942 1000 USD against 40,542 1000 USD in Eastern Asia, a difference of 40,400 1000 USD.
That makes Germany's figure about 2.0 times Eastern Asia's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 49 shared years of data; in 1968 it was Germany ahead.
Eastern Asia ranks 9th and Germany ranks 2nd of 28 groups.
Germany has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Eastern Asia | Germany |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 20,630 1000 USD | 26,527 1000 USD | 5,896 1000 USD | Germany |
| 1970s | 30,644 1000 USD | 64,964 1000 USD | 34,320 1000 USD | Germany |
| 1980s | 86,284 1000 USD | 111,466 1000 USD | 25,182 1000 USD | Germany |
| 1990s | 128,137 1000 USD | 134,164 1000 USD | 6,027 1000 USD | Germany |
| 2000s | 70,229 1000 USD | 128,816 1000 USD | 58,587 1000 USD | Germany |
| 2010s | 65,798 1000 USD | 123,667 1000 USD | 57,869 1000 USD | Germany |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
